Leaving Space for Movement

Especially if you have several major furniture pieces you want to place in the room, it’s important to consider how space for movement will be affected. Make sure you leave several feet of open area between furniture pieces so people can move around with ease.

A common error from first-timers here is focusing too much on the walls for furniture placement, but leaving open space in the middle of a room can be just as important. Don’t fill every inch of your space with a furniture piece or other decorative item – there should be room to move around and continue conversations comfortably!

The Concept of Furniture Balance

As you’re going about arranging your furniture, the concept of balance should be understood and taken into consideration. You don’t want to have all of your furniture pushed to one wall or corner, as this can create an unbalanced and off-putting look.

Instead, you should strive for a balanced distribution of furniture across the room – if there’s a particular focal point like a fireplace or television, be sure that your heavier items are placed on either side of it in order to create balance. Keep in mind that lighter furnishings like end tables and lamps can be used to even out heavier items or brighten up a dark corner.

Consider Your Habits

Another key takeaway when it comes to furniture arrangement is understanding how you and your family members use the room. If you tend to spend a lot of time watching television or reading books, make sure that comfortable seating is placed close to these activities.

Don’t be afraid to get creative with your furniture placement either. Using ottomans in lieu of coffee tables, opting for a sectional sofa and utilizing unique pieces like armoires or chaise lounges can be great ways to make your space feel interesting without feeling cramped.
